|
|
|
|
@ -32,6 +32,7 @@ import com.keylesspalace.tusky.interfaces.LinkListener
|
|
|
|
|
import com.keylesspalace.tusky.util.BindingHolder |
|
|
|
|
import com.keylesspalace.tusky.util.EmojiSpan |
|
|
|
|
import com.keylesspalace.tusky.util.emojify |
|
|
|
|
import com.keylesspalace.tusky.util.parseAsMastodonHtml |
|
|
|
|
import com.keylesspalace.tusky.util.setClickableText |
|
|
|
|
import java.lang.ref.WeakReference |
|
|
|
|
|
|
|
|
|
@ -60,7 +61,7 @@ class AnnouncementAdapter(
|
|
|
|
|
val chips = holder.binding.chipGroup |
|
|
|
|
val addReactionChip = holder.binding.addReactionChip |
|
|
|
|
|
|
|
|
|
val emojifiedText: CharSequence = item.content.emojify(item.emojis, text, animateEmojis) |
|
|
|
|
val emojifiedText: CharSequence = item.content.parseAsMastodonHtml().emojify(item.emojis, text, animateEmojis) |
|
|
|
|
|
|
|
|
|
setClickableText(text, emojifiedText, item.mentions, item.tags, listener) |
|
|
|
|
|
|
|
|
|
|